2. Yield Prediction
Accurate yield prediction is a central objective of the 2025 Colorado Wheat Tour. Forecasting harvest outcomes provides critical information for stakeholders across the agricultural value chain. From farmers making planting decisions to millers anticipating grain availability, reliable yield estimates facilitate informed planning and resource allocation.
-
Field-Level Observations
Experts conducting the tour will make detailed observations within representative wheat fields. These observations include assessing factors such as plant height, head density, and kernel size. Noting the prevalence of disease or signs of stress from environmental factors like drought or heat contributes to a comprehensive understanding of potential yield limitations. For example, a field exhibiting stunted growth due to drought stress will likely have a lower yield than a healthy, well-developed field.
-
Statistical Modeling
Historical data, combined with current field observations, informs statistical models used to predict yields. These models consider factors like planting dates, weather patterns, soil conditions, and historical yield data from comparable regions. Sophisticated models incorporate climate data, allowing analysts to assess the potential impact of temperature fluctuations or precipitation patterns on final yields. A model might project a lower yield if historical data, combined with current weather patterns, indicates insufficient rainfall during critical growth stages.
-
Technological Advancements
Technological advancements, such as remote sensing and satellite imagery, are increasingly integrated into yield prediction methods. These technologies provide a broader perspective on crop conditions across large geographical areas. Drones equipped with multispectral cameras can capture detailed images of fields, providing information on plant health and vigor that might not be readily apparent through ground-level observation. Analyzing spectral data allows for early identification of stress factors and more precise yield forecasts.

4. Market Analysis
Market analysis plays a crucial role in interpreting the data collected during the 2025 Colorado Wheat Tour. By connecting on-the-ground observations of crop conditions with broader market trends, analysts can provide valuable insights into potential price fluctuations, supply availability, and overall market stability. This analysis helps stakeholders across the agricultural supply chain make informed decisions, from farmers planning their planting strategies to millers and bakers anticipating grain prices.
-
Supply and Demand Dynamics
Projected yields from the wheat tour directly influence supply projections. A significant decrease in anticipated yield due to drought or disease could tighten supply, potentially leading to price increases. Conversely, a bumper crop might lead to a surplus, putting downward pressure on prices. Understanding these dynamics allows market participants to anticipate price movements and adjust their purchasing and selling strategies accordingly. For example, a miller anticipating a tight supply might secure forward contracts to guarantee access to wheat at a predetermined price.
-
Quality Considerations
The quality of the wheat crop, as assessed during the tour, also significantly impacts market value. Factors like protein content, kernel size, and test weight influence the suitability of wheat for different end-uses. High-protein wheat, suitable for bread making, commands a premium price compared to lower-protein wheat used for animal feed. Market analysis considers these quality factors alongside yield projections to provide a comprehensive view of market dynamics. A large yield of low-protein wheat might not translate into high market returns if demand for that specific quality is limited.
-
Global Market Influences
Colorado’s wheat market does not exist in isolation. Global production trends, international trade policies, and currency fluctuations all influence domestic prices. Market analysis considers these global factors in conjunction with data from the Colorado Wheat Tour to provide a holistic understanding of market conditions. For example, a strong global wheat harvest could offset the impact of a reduced yield in Colorado, mitigating potential price increases.
